In this article, we'll explore some of the advanced features of CSS Grid that can take your web development skills to the next level. Responsive Layouts One of the key features of CSS Grid is its ability to create responsive layouts that automatically adjust based on the size of the screen. By using the `grid-template-areas` property, developers can define different layout configurations for various screen sizes. This allows for a more seamless user experience across different devices, from desktops to smartphones. Grid Gap Another useful feature of CSS Grid is the `grid-gap` property, which allows developers to add space between grid items. By adjusting the spacing between elements, developers can create visually appealing layouts that are easy to read and navigate. This feature is especially useful for creating clean and organized designs that enhance the user experience. Grid Template Rows and Columns CSS Grid also provides the ability to define the size of rows and columns within a grid layout using properties like `grid-template-rows` and `grid-template-columns`. This feature allows for more precise control over the layout of elements within a grid, making it easier to create complex designs with multiple rows and columns. Auto-Fit and Minmax Functions One of the more advanced features of CSS Grid is the `auto-fit` and `minmax` functions, which allow developers to create flexible grid layouts that adapt to the content within them. By using these functions, developers can define minimum and maximum sizes for grid items, ensuring that they resize dynamically based on the available space. Browser Support According to recent statistics, CSS Grid is currently supported by all major web browsers, including Chrome, Firefox, Safari, and Edge. This widespread support makes CSS Grid an ideal choice for developers looking to create modern and responsive layouts that work seamlessly across different platforms. Conclusion Overall, CSS Grid offers a wealth of advanced features that can help developers create modern and responsive web designs. By leveraging these features, developers can create visually stunning layouts that adapt to different screen sizes and devices. With its widespread browser support and powerful capabilities, CSS Grid is a must-have tool for any developer looking to take their web development skills to the next level. Explore the complete details here: https://www.mybrooksmoving.com/coping-with-nostalgia-while-embracing-a-new-life-in-merrimack/ Essential Java Loop Concepts for Professional Programmers